Charles is a graduate form the University of Surrey and joined as an associate in 2006. Before gaining his chiropractic qualification Charles read neuroscience at the University of Nottingham.

 

During his time in practice Charles has treated hundreds of patients and a wide variety of conditions. Although most of his cases have been mechanical problems such as whiplash and low back pain he has also treated conditions with systemic features such as ankylosing spondylitis and psoriatic arthritis. Charles also has experience treating children for spinal disorders.

 

In accordance with the General Chiropractic Council governing guidelines since graduating Charles has attended a number of conferences and seminars to further his skills and improve his scope of practice as a chiropractor.
